About Me



Comprised of four of West Texas' most seasoned and sought-after musicians, Dingo Sanctuary traces its roots through previous West Texas powerhouse rock bands such as The Atomics and Lighthouse. With a reputation for technical arrangements, meticulous attention to live sound presentation, and obsessive musicianship, the band has earned praise as one of the tightest, most impressive club acts to be found anywhere.
Fronted by singer Rob Salinas and veteran guitarist/singer Tim Kreitz, Dingo Sanctuary cranks out an incendiary mix of original and cover music spanning a wide rock gamut from Led Zeppelin to U2 to The Allman Brothers to Rush. Rounded out by Britt Parker and Roger Albaugh in the rhythm section, this unique West Texas rock gem pleases crowds all over the region with an eclectic rock-n-roll experience that must be heard live to be fully appreciated.
Dingo Sanctuary is currently supporting their latest studio album,The Wild Dog & Pony Show.
